Anyone who knows anything of history knows that great social changes are impossible without feminine upheaval. Social progress can be measured exactly by the social position of the fair sex, the ugly ones included.
Karl Marx
ShareWTF𝕏

Interpretation

What this quote means

This quote emphasizes the crucial role women play in driving social change and progress.

Karl Marx highlights that significant social transformations in history are closely tied to the involvement and upheaval of women. He asserts that the status of women, regardless of their appearance, serves as a metric for measuring societal advancement, indicating that true progress cannot occur without acknowledging and addressing the disparities faced by women.
